China Unicom plans to boost CDMA capacity fivefold in Shanghai, threefold in China



(8 March 2001) Zhao Le, general manager of China Unicom’s Shanghai branch, said
that the latter would recommence development of the code division multiple access
(CDMA) mobile communications network.

China Unicom established a new development plan after the management and
operation of the CDMA network was officially transferred to the company. By the end of
2001, Shanghai’s CDMA network will support 500,000 subscribers, and the number will
increase to 3 million by 2003, according to the March 7 Wenhui Bao (Wenhui Daily).

The total capacity of the nationwide CDMA network will be 13 million users and the
interconnection of the network will be completed by the end of the year. Within three
years, China’s total CDMA capacity will be 50 million
